.TH Command TRADE
.NA trade "Buy planes/ships/land units"
.LV Expert
.SY "trade"
The trade report lists
all ships, planes and land units that are being sold and allows you
to buy them.
.s1
It is based on a bidding system, and after the bidding time has passed,
the transactions are executed, and the highest bidder gets the goods
(maybe.) If there are no bidders once the time passes, the goods stay
on the market and the first bidder will get them.
.s1
Your bid must be higher than the currently high bid.
.s1

The cargo of ships and land units are listed in the square
brackets, in this case, 4 guns and 40 shells. The nuclear armament of
planes is listed in parentheses.
